Crum & Forster Company Overview
Crum & Forster (C&F) provides market leading property & casualty, accident & health, specialty and standard commercial lines insurance solutions. A true underwriting company, we have a 200-year history of helping our customers manage risk with laser-focused expertise, integrity and discipline. Our people are empowered to make decisions and problem-solve with you smartly and swiftly. Our annual gross written premium is 6.2 billion. C&F enjoys a financial strength rating of "A+" (Superior) by AM Best.
Our most valuable asset is our people. We have 3000 employees, and locations throughout the United States and India. With our employee-first focus, the Company is consistently recognized as a great place to work, earning multiple workplace and wellness awards, including the Great Place to Work® Award, Fortune 100 Best Companies to Work For, Fortune Best Workplaces for Parents, Fortune Best Workplaces for Millennials, and many others.
C&F is part of Fairfax Financial Holdings. For more information about C&F, please visit our website: www.cfins.com
Job Description
The Business Strategy & Execution Lead is a promotional opportunity for Senior Business Analysts who demonstrate strong consultative, analytical, and cross-functional leadership skills. This role is focused on helping business stakeholders define operational needs, assess opportunities, shape strategic initiatives, and engage effectively with Digital Services. The Business Strategy & Execution Lead serves as a day-to-day liaison between the business and Digital, evaluates business performance and operational effectiveness, and helps coordinate cross-functional efforts through completion in alignment with business priorities.
The Business Strategy & Execution Lead role requires an advanced understanding of insurance workflows, systems, and operational processes, along with strong business analysis, stakeholder coordination, problem-solving, and delivery support skills. The successful candidate will be proactive, service-oriented, and comfortable operating in ambiguous, fast-moving environments where they must earn stakeholder trust, recognize emerging business needs, and guide effective engagement between business teams and Digital Services.
The Business Strategy & Execution Lead is a member of the Surplus & Specialty Lines (SSL) Digital Services team, supporting Underwriting, Claims, and Billing & Collections business units, as well as strategic business initiatives across the organization. This role works closely with business leaders, business analysts, and key cross-functional partners including actuarial, data science, digital/IT, operations, and claims to advance divisional priorities. SSL underwrites both admitted and non-admitted business for General Liability, Automobile Liability, Workers Compensation, Property, Inland Marine, and Excess/Umbrella lines of business across multiple industry verticals, including but not limited to Contracting, Energy, Security, and Environmental.
